Kosovo needs functioning legal aid system, says OSCE Mission report
Publishing date: 8 June 2007
PRISTINA, 8 June 2007- Kosovo does not have a functioning legal aid system for civil cases, posing challenges to free and effective legal representation, concludes a new report from the OSCE Mission in Kosovo.
OSCE Chairman welcomes arrest of war crimes indictee Zdravko Tolimir
Publishing date: 2 June 2007
Content type: Press release
Where we are: OSCE Chairmanship, OSCE Mission to Serbia
What we do: Rule of law
MADRID, 2 June 2007- The OSCE Chairman-in-Office, Spanish Foreign Minister Miguel Angel Moratinos, said today he welcomed the arrest of war crimes indictee Zdravko Tolimir yesterday on the Bosnian-Serbian border.
